Why Battery Backup Systems Are Essential

Battery backup systems provide immediate power when the main electricity supply fails. Unlike generators, they operate silently, require minimal maintenance, and switch instantly without disruption.

Key Benefits

  • Uninterrupted Power Supply: Keeps essential appliances and systems running during outages.
  • Equipment Protection: Prevents damage caused by sudden power loss or surges.
  • Energy Efficiency: Modern systems optimize power usage and reduce wastage.
  • Quiet Operation: No noise compared to fuel-powered generators.
  • Eco-Friendly: Reduced reliance on fossil fuels.

Types of Battery Backup Systems

Understanding the different types of systems helps in selecting the most suitable solution.

1.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S)

Ideal for short-term backup, UPS systems are commonly used for computers, networking equipment, and small office setups.

2. Inverter Battery Systems

These systems convert stored DC power into AC electricity, making them suitable for powering household appliances during outages.

3. Solar Battery Backup Systems

Integrated with solar panels, these systems store energy for use during power cuts or at night, offering long-term savings.

4. Hybrid Systems

A combination of grid, solar, and battery storage, hybrid systems provide maximum flexibility and efficiency.

Comparison of Battery Backup Options

System Type Best For Backup Duration Cost Level Maintenance
UPS Computers, routers Short Low Low
Inverter Systems Homes, small businesses Medium Moderate Moderate
Solar Battery Systems Energy independence Long High Low
Hybrid Systems Large homes, offices Very Long High Moderate

Key Components of a Battery Backup System

A complete system includes several components working together:

  • Batteries: Store electrical energy.
  • Inverter: Converts DC to AC power.
  • Charge Controller: Regulates battery charging.
  • Monitoring System: Tracks performance and usage.
  • Switching Mechanism: Automatically switches power sources.

Factors to Consider Before Installation

Before investing in a battery backup system, consider the following:

  • Power Requirements: Determine essential loads.
  • Battery Capacity: Measured in kWh or Ah.
  • Budget: Initial cost vs long-term savings.
  • Space Availability: Installation area for batteries and equipment.
  • Scalability: Ability to expand the system in the future.

Cost Overview

The cost of installing a battery backup system varies depending on system size, battery type, and complexity.

System Size Estimated Cost Range Suitable For
Small KES 30,000 – 100,000 Homes, small offices
Medium KES 100,000 – 300,000 Medium businesses
Large KES 300,000+ Industrial applications

Maintenance Tips for Longevity

Proper maintenance extends the life of your system:

  • Regularly check battery health.
  • Keep systems clean and dust-free.
  • Ensure proper ventilation.
  • Schedule periodic professional inspections.

Future of Energy Backup Solutions

Advancements in battery technology, such as lithium-ion systems, are improving efficiency, lifespan, and storage capacity. Integration with smart systems allows users to monitor and control energy usage remotely, making backup solutions more intelligent and user-friendly.
